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Maryport to Northfleet start from as little as £49.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Maryport to Northfleet start from £117.30 one way, or £167.70 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Maryport to Northfleet are available for £229.30 one way, or £458.60 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ities at Maryport Station

Maryport station, although small, ensures that travelers can navigate through the facility and onward to their destinations with efficiency. One of the key highlights is the availability of ticket machines, where passengers can conveniently collect tickets that they've purchased online. Keep in mind that there is no staffed ticket office, so it's wise to plan ahead if accessibility is a consideration, as unfortunately, the ticket machines aren't suited for all accessibility needs.

While the station lacks some modern amenities, it does feature necessary components like CCTV for safety. Unfortunately, typical facilities such as waiting rooms, accessible toilets, and refreshment kiosks aren't available at Maryport. However, there is a seating area for those waiting for their train. Facilities and Amenities

Northfleet station caters to travelers with a range of facilities carefully tailored to assist in ticket purchasing and support services. The ticket office operates during the weekday mornings from 06:10 to 10:10, complementing this with user-friendly ticket machines available for use at any time. You can also collect tickets bought online with ease, as the machines are conveniently located in the station forecourt.

For those needing special assistance, Northfleet provides step-free access to certain areas of the station, though travelers should be aware that platform interchange without steps is not possible. Access to platform 2 is designed for comfort while boarding services away from London, but platform 1, which caters towards London, involves stair access only.
